Classic Strawberries and Cream

Prep Time:15 mins
Cook Time:0 mins
Total Time:15 mins
Servings: 4

Ingredients

  • 500 g fresh strawberries
  • 2 tbsp granulated sugar
  • 240 ml heavy cream
  • 2 tbsp powdered sugar
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• 4 leaves mint leaves (optional, for garnish)

Directions

Step 1

Rinse the fresh strawberries thoroughly under cold water and pat them dry with a clean towel.

Step 2

Hull the strawberries by removing the green tops and slice them into halves or quarters, depending on their size.

Step 3

Place the sliced strawberries in a mixing bowl and sprinkle them with the granulated sugar. Gently toss to coat the strawberries evenly, then set aside to macerate for 10 minutes. This will release their juices and enhance their sweetness.

Step 4

While the strawberries are resting, prepare the whipped cream. In a large, chilled mixing bowl, pour the heavy cream.

Step 5

Add the powdered sugar and vanilla extract to the cream. Using a hand mixer or whisk, whip the cream until soft peaks form. Be careful not to overwhip, as it could turn into butter.

Step 6

Spoon the macerated strawberries into serving bowls or glasses, ensuring each portion has a bit of the juices.

Step 7

Top each serving with a generous dollop of the freshly whipped cream.

Step 8

Garnish with a mint leaf, if desired, for an extra touch of freshness.

Step 9

Serve immediately and enjoy the delightful combination of sweet and creamy flavors!
